The EH&S professional operating as the sole EH&S and medical response presence on site during second shift. Works without on-site management, without a supervising clinician and without the meeting and approval structure available during core hours. Accountable for safety compliance verification across the off-shift operating population and for occupational health and emergency medical response to night-shift employees.The defining requirement of the role is sound independent judgment: decisions are made in the moment, alone, and documented afterward rather than discussed beforehand.Job DescriptionSafety verification on the operating floor (approx. 70% of role)
- Verifies compliance with applicable safety requirements through direct, continuous observation of equipment, work practices and conditions while production is running —access that is not available during core hours.
- Identifies unsafe equipment and conditions and removes them from service immediately under delegated stop-work authority, then documents. Acts first and reports after where personnel are at risk.
- Observes work practices as they are actually performed rather than as procedures describe them, and coaches at the point of work.
- Conducts scheduled inspections of equipment, systems, emergency provisions and workplace conditions, and maintains the resulting inspection records to audit standard.
- Uses uninterrupted off-shift hours for the documentation, procedure development and records work that cannot be completed during the operating day, producing drafts for day-shift review and approval.
- Engages directly with off-shift crews to surface hazards and concerns that are not raised through daytime channels.
- Serves as the sole trained emergency medical responder on site during the shift. Assesses, treats within scope of practice, and makes the independent decision to arrange transport or activate emergency services without a supervising clinician available on site.
- Maintains emergency medical and first aid readiness across the site: supplies, equipment condition and expiry, responder coverage across all areas and break rotations.
- Maintains the occupational health surveillance status of off-shift employees, tracks who is due for required evaluation or testing, and coordinates scheduling into core hours where the provider is only available during the day.
- Identifies off-shift tasks, processes and exposures that daytime occupational health and hygiene activity does not capture, and ensures they are brought into scope.
- Responds to incidents in a dual capacity —treating the injured person and initiating the investigation —and maintains objectivity between the two.
- Secures the scene, captures physical evidence, photographs conditions and obtains witness accounts before the end of the shift, recognizing that off-shift evidence and witnesses are unavailable by the following morning.
- Provides the complete factual investigation package to the client's EH&S lead, who retains the regulatory determination and reporting decision.
- Produces a written shift record every shift, including shifts with no findings.
- Distinguishes reliably between what to resolve independently and what to escalate, and escalates without delay anything requiring management authorization, expenditure, procurement, human resources involvement, external coordination or a decision reserved to the client.
- Operates within the authority delegated in writing by the client and does not act outside it.
- Second shift, in an active manufacturing environment, in required PPE. Predominantly floor-based, including elevated areas, restricted spaces, and outdoor conditions.
- Sole EH&S presence on site for the duration of the shift. Lone-working protocols apply.
